DTC    B2779    Engine Starter Communication Malfunction

for Preparation Click here


DESCRIPTION

If communication between the remote start ECU and certification ECU (smart key ECU assembly) cannot be performed even if a remote start operation is performed to try changing the power source mode to on (IG) or start the hybrid control system, this DTC is stored.
When the remote start ECU does not respond to the certification ECU (smart key ECU assembly), this DTC is stored. When communication with the remote start ECU is established and a remote start operation is performed, this DTC is cleared.

INSPECTION PROCEDURE

NOTICE:
  1. Inspect the fuses for circuits related to this system before performing the following inspection procedure.
  2. Before performing the inspection, check that DTC U0142 is not output.
  3. Before replacing the certification ECU (smart key ECU assembly), refer to the Service Bulletin.
  4. After performing repair, perform the operation that fulfills the DTC output confirmation operation, and then confirm that no DTCs are output again.

HINT:
In this repair manual, only the terminal numbers used for inspection between the main body ECU (multiplex network body ECU) and option connector are listed.
